Output 020999bfaf8ac3ec6408e320ddadc2a2595bd80c319195ee6ae2f956a60d612d:1

value
172213552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37d420f5fa09a1d59875277ef52cee4f4bd364ec OP_EQUAL
address
MCzMWwmLnh9GGco7eES43ec5gBU3NdTSPL
transaction
020999bfaf8ac3ec6408e320ddadc2a2595bd80c319195ee6ae2f956a60d612d
spent
true